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Veracode

  • No public pricing; customers must request a demo and custom quote.
  • Full platform capability spans many modules, which can require significant onboarding.
  • Package Firewall and PTaaS are separate add-ons rather than included by default.
  • Primarily built for enterprise scale, less suited to small individual projects.

Semgrep

  • Free tier caps out at 10 contributors and 10 repositories.
  • Secrets scanning is priced as a separate module ($15/contributor) from Code and Supply Chain.
  • Self-managed repositories and custom CI/CD require the Enterprise tier.
  • AI credits are limited per tier and additional usage requires upgrading.

Answered from the vendors’ own pages

Semgrep: What does Semgrep cost?

The Free edition covers up to 10 contributors; Teams starts at $30/contributor/month for Code scanning (Supply Chain also $30, Secrets $15); Enterprise is custom-priced.

Source
Semgrep: Is there a free plan, and what are its limits?

Yes, the Free edition supports up to 10 contributors and 10 repositories with Code and Supply Chain scanning plus 60 AI credits total.

Source
Semgrep: How is usage metered?

Pricing is per contributor, defined as someone who made at least one commit to a scanned private repository in the past 90 days.

Source
Semgrep: Is there special pricing for startups?

Yes, Semgrep offers special startup pricing upon request for early-stage companies.
